The Hanover Insurance Group Accounting Manager Salaries in Boston

The average The Hanover Insurance Group Accounting Manager in Boston earns an estimated $103,097 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$92,912 with a $10,185 bonus. The Hanover Insurance Group's Accounting Manager compensation is $4,734 more than the US average for a Accounting Manager. Accounting Manager salaries at The Hanover Insurance Group in Boston can range from $50,500 - $182,000.

In Boston, The Finance Department at The Hanover Insurance Group earns $4,189 more on average than the HR Department.
